The Form S-8 Registration Statement Under the Securities Act of
1933 as fil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ission by Data
Measurement Corporation on August 5, 1992 (Registration No. 33-
50982) is hereby amended by the substitution of the revised pages
23, 23A, 23B, 23C and 23D attached hereto as Exhibit 1 for the
pages 23, 23A, 23B and 23C submitted as a part thereof, as
previously amended.  Those pages have been modified to include
specific reference to all of the prospective Selling Shareholders
who as of July 7, 1995 had indicated an intention to sell
shares pursuant to this Offering.  The changes to pages 23, 23A,
23B and 23C also required a change to the table of contents on
page 2 of the Registration Statement due to the repagination of
two items listed thereon from page 23C to page 23D.  A revised
page 2 is attached hereto as Exhibit 2 to replace the existing
page 2.

                      PLAN OF DISTRIBUTION

     The Shares may be sold from time to time by the Selling
Shareholders or their pledgees or donees.  Such sales may be made
in the NASDAQ or in negotiated transactions, at prices and on
terms then prevailing or at prices related to the then current
market price or at negotiated prices.  The Shares may be sold by
one or more of the following methods:  (a) a block trade in which
the broker or dealer so engaged will attempt to sell the Shares
as agent but may position and resell a portion of the block as
principal to facilitate the transaction; (b) purchases by a
broker or dealer as principal and resale by such broker or dealer
for its account pursuant to this Prospectus; and (c) ordinary
brokerage transactions and transactions in which the broker

                             EXPERTS

     The financial statements and the related supplemental
schedules incorporated in the Prospectus by reference from the
Company's Form 10-K have been audited by Deloitte & Touche,
independent accountants, and, with respect to certain of the
Company's foreign subsidiary operations, Sinclairs, independent
accountants, as stated in their opinions, which are incorporated
herein by reference, and have been so incorporated in reliance
upon such opinions given upon the authority of those firms as
experts in accounting and auditing.

                       FURTHER INFORMATION

     Additional information with respect to the Employee Option
Plan and the Directors Option Plan, including options outstanding
thereunder, eligible persons and the composition of the Committee
that administers the plans and the Board of Directors, may be
provided in the future to participants by means of the appendices
to this Prospectus.  A copy of the Company's most recent Annual
Report to Shareholders and a copy of this Prospectus will be
delivered to each holder of an option.  In addition, all holders
of options will be sent copies of future appendices to this
Prospectus, annual reports, proxy statements and other
communications distributed to shareholders generally.  A
participant will not be furnished a new copy of this Prospectus
unless he or she requests it or unless changes have occurred
making it necessary to revise this Prospectus.
